Chapter Eleven — SGML Functions (continued)
Overview
The XBRLLoad function loads an instance.
Syntax/Parameters
Syntax
handle = XBRLLoad ( string filename | handle hObject );
Parameters
filename
A string to a qualified path and filename. Or,
hObject
A handle to an SGML, Edit or Mapped Text Object.
Return Value
Returns a handle to an XBRL Object or NULL_HANDLE on failure. Use the GetLastError function to retrieve error information. When processing has been completed, the script should use the CloseHandle function to discard the handle.
Remarks
The function will load the specified only from iXBRL, [XML XBRL, JSON or CSV XBRL].
